   I'm in the process of setting up my backups on my RS/6000 model
320, version 3002.  I'd like to be able to dump all my filesystems
on the same tape, but the backup command is refusing to cooperate.
I'm trying to use the command 
   backup -0 -f /dev/rmt0.1 file_system_name

What I thought this would do would be to use the non-rewind feature
and then let me run the next backup comand for the next filesystem.
What happens, however, is that the backup command still rewinds to
the beginning before starting the next backup.  I'd be grateful for
any insights.
